Common Types of Assessment Queries You May Face

Numerical Reasoning: Expect problems where you must interpret data from charts, graphs, or tables to solve math-based puzzles. These could involve percentages, ratios, or simple arithmetic. Be prepared for questions that test your ability to work under time pressure.

Logical Thinking: These focus on patterns and sequences, requiring you to recognize relationships between shapes, numbers, or letters. Practice with sequences, grouping, and odd-one-out tasks to boost accuracy and speed.

Verbal Reasoning: This section assesses your capacity to analyze written content. You may encounter tasks where you have to identify the meaning of words based on context, infer conclusions, or deduce logical sequences from text. Speed reading and comprehension techniques can help here.

Abstract Reasoning: Often, you’ll need to work with unfamiliar shapes or patterns and deduce logical connections. These puzzles test your ability to think creatively and solve problems with little to no prior knowledge. Regular practice with visual puzzles enhances performance in this area.

Situational Judgement: These assess your decision-making skills in hypothetical workplace scenarios. You’ll need to identify the most appropriate action to take from a set of options. Focus on understanding common workplace values, such as teamwork and problem-solving, to make better choices.

Spatial Awareness: Here, you’ll need to mentally manipulate objects or shapes, such as visualizing how a 3D object would appear when rotated. Building skills in geometry and practicing with block puzzles can sharpen your spatial reasoning.

How to Solve Numerical Reasoning Problems

Work through each problem systematically. Start by identifying the type of mathematical operation required, such as addition, subtraction, multiplication, or division. Look for clues in the question, such as keywords or numbers that stand out, which can help you decide the best approach.

Before doing any calculations, simplify the problem if possible. For example, round numbers for quick approximations when exact precision isn’t necessary. This can speed up your thought process and help you narrow down the answer faster.

When dealing with percentages or ratios, convert them to simpler forms for easier manipulation. For instance, convert a percentage to a decimal by dividing it by 100. If a ratio is given, express it in terms of a fraction for simpler arithmetic.

Break down complex problems into smaller parts. If a problem contains multiple steps, solve each step separately. For example, in problems involving multiple operations, follow the order of operations (PEMDAS: Parentheses, Exponents, Multiplication and Division, Addition and Subtraction) to avoid errors.

If faced with word problems, underline or highlight key data. This ensures that you don’t overlook important details and helps you focus on the relevant information. Sometimes, restating the question in your own words can clarify what is being asked.

  • For problems involving sequences or patterns, look for regular intervals or repeated cycles that can simplify predictions.
  • For distance, speed, and time problems, use the basic formula: Distance = Speed × Time. Make sure the units are consistent throughout the problem.

In multiple-choice scenarios, eliminate clearly incorrect options first. This increases your chances of choosing the correct one, especially when under time pressure.

Lastly, practice is key. The more you expose yourself to different problem types, the faster and more accurate your solutions will become. Set a timer when practicing to simulate the pressure of real scenarios.

Strategies for Answering Verbal Reasoning Tasks

Focus on key details. Identify the core message of the passage, especially in complex texts. Avoid overanalyzing every word. Look for keywords that point to the main argument or conclusion.

Practice scanning for context. Sometimes, questions require interpreting the tone, intent, or implied meaning rather than literal comprehension. Skim through the passage to get a sense of its direction before reading in-depth.

Watch for word cues. Words like “except”, “all”, “some”, and “none” can drastically change the meaning of a statement. Pay attention to qualifiers that could influence your answer.

Use elimination. If you’re uncertain, remove options that are clearly incorrect. This increases your chances of selecting the correct response by narrowing down possibilities.

Manage time wisely. If a task is taking too long, move on to the next one. Return later with a fresh perspective if necessary. Speed is important, but accuracy is critical, so avoid rushing through without proper evaluation.

Consider different perspectives. If you’re asked to infer or assume something, evaluate the passage from multiple angles. Be open to reading between the lines, but don’t make unwarranted assumptions.

Time Management Tips During an Aptitude Challenge

Set a strict time limit for each section. Allocate a specific amount of minutes per problem, and stick to it. If you hit a roadblock, move on and return to the tricky ones later.

Prioritize questions that are easier and quicker to solve. This builds confidence and secures points early on. Save the more complex ones for the last part of the session.

Practice mental math. Speed in calculations can save crucial minutes. Familiarize yourself with shortcuts and estimation techniques to reduce time spent on simple arithmetic.

Read each prompt carefully, but briefly. Don’t waste time re-reading instructions. Focus on the key points to understand what’s being asked right away.

If the format allows, skip questions that require excessive time or are too challenging. It’s better to leave one unsolved than to risk running out of time while struggling with it.

Stay calm. Anxiety can waste time. Keep a steady pace, and if you find yourself rushing or panicking, pause for a few seconds to reset.

At the start, glance over the entire set to estimate how long each section might take. This helps you manage your time efficiently as you progress through the exercises.

Don’t forget to keep track of the time during the process. Checking the clock periodically can help you assess your progress and adjust your pace accordingly.
